“The island closest to paradise”, as the Japanese writer Katsura Morimura called it. Magnificent nickname that has stuck with him, as it suits him perfectly. This atoll in the Coral Sea, in the northeast of New Caledonia, is indeed often presented as one of the most beautiful in the Pacific. Imagine a jewel, placed in the middle of the crystal clear waters of the ocean. An exceptionally rich seabed. Bright white sand beaches that stretch for miles.
